Jag Rally Falls Short as ULM Clinches Series

MONROE, La. | South Alabama loaded the bases with no outs in the top of the seventy, but ULM reliever Ashante McDade retired the final three batters to seal the 2-1 win and clinch the series for the Warhawks Saturday afternoon at the ULM Softball Stadium.

Quotable – head coach Becky Clark
- On the loss: "Today was another tough one. We went in with a game plan that unfortunately we did not execute. I thought we did the same thing over and over at the plate without making adjustments. There has to be more dig in when it comes to adjusting to what the game is giving you."

Key Moments
•    South Alabama (19-14, 3-2 SWBC) took the early lead with a run in the top of the first as Presley Lively led off the game with an infield single, and two batters later scored on Virginia Mambelli's RBI single
•    Lively was initially ruled out, but after review, obstruction was called allowing the run to count (USA, 1-0)
•    ULM (19-15, 3-2 SBC) threatened to even the game back up in the bottom half of the opening frame, placing runners at the corners with two outs after Hollie Thomas' single to right, but Sydney Scapin (4-5) was able to get a foul out to third to end the inning
•    The Warhawks loaded the bases with two outs in their half of the second, but Scapin was able to get a ground out to second to end the threat
•    Brooklin Lippert and Meagan Brown both walked with one out in the bottom of the fifth, and two batter later, with the two Warhawk runners at second and third after a wild pitch, Thomas lined a single to left center to plate the pair (ULM, 2-1)
•    South Alabama had a chance to answer back the next half inning as Gracie Dees drew a leadoff walk to begin the Jaguar sixth and pinch runner Caitlyn Gavin moved into scoring position on a ground out, but ULM starter Skylar Waggoner (5-3) was able to get a foul out to first and a line out to first to end the inning
•    The Warhawks threatened to add to their lead placing a pair on after a leadoff double by Olivia Fagaard and a walk by Ellie Carter, but Ryley Harrison was able to retire the next three batters to maintain the deficit at one
•    The Jaguars attempted to rally back in the top of the seventh, loading the bases after a double by Lillie Stagner – who just missed a home run – to lead off the inning, and singles by Sydney Stewart and Brooklynn Bockhaus, but McDade was able to retire the final three batters and pick up her first save of the spring

Key Stats
•    Lively was one of five Jags to record a hit and scored the lone run in the loss
•    Stagner had a double and Mambelli reached base twice with a hit and a walk to go along with a RBI
•    Waggoner held South Alabama without a hit in the second through sixth innings
•    Thomas was 2-for-3 at the plate for the Warhawks with two RBI
•    South Alabama was 0-for-7 with two outs and 0-for-3 with a runner at third and less than two outs

Postgame Notes
•    With her leadoff single to start the game, Lively has reached base safely in eight of her last 10, and had a hit in four-straight games and seven of her last nine
•    Mambelli has had a hit in 17 of her last 25, and driven in a run in seven of her last 12
•    Mambelli now has 13 games with both a hit and a RBI this spring
•    Branstetter has reached base safely in each of her last five games with her walk
•    Stagner has had a hit in five of her last eight
